Pampered Felines - Ideas for Cat ToysHere are some of the hit ideas for the best and
most loved cat toys for your pampered felines. These toys will pass on
perfectly as gifts on the cat's birthday or her adoption anniversary day
and are actually for those cats, who seem to have virtually everything.
TV video cassettes and CDs that show squirrels, birds, fish and mice,
complete with the sounds of the animals and the background sounds of the
outdoors such as that of the wind or the jungle. Watch the TV with you
cat as both of you recline on the couch, while you can have your popcorn
and your cat, her stock of catnip treats. Cats love to scratch, so why
not her gift her a scratching post. The sturdy carpet-covered post can
also shed off kitty' treats for her greater amusement and will also
motivate her to scratch the post instead of furniture or carpeting,
every time the urge to scratch starts overwhelming her.
A transparent and sturdy glass jar to keep the treats fresh and toys safe and exhibit able comes in handy to lure the cat away from naughtiness. The secretive cats would love a private place to snooze and the lightweight expandable sturdy tunnel is just the thing for your pampered feline. For the cat lovers, you can chose a cat treat jar packed beautifully, with a top that can be securely fastened and can only be opened by the owner and not by the cat. On the other hand, you may also consider a doorbell for your cat that allows him to ring you whenever she needs your service or is hungry. It can be placed besides the cat door in the home, so she doesn't need to scratch the door, every time she wants to come in but can just chime the bell just like gentlemen and ladies. A warm cushion is just the thing for cats and will keep her warm and comfortable always.
